Could be lan, your computer pinging other network devices or causing your router to check on attached devices, but it could also just be the vibration of you walking around moved her mouse just enough to wake it.  That would explain the inconsistency of it happening.

If you don't want to mess with her computer, you could always just unplug it from the router and see if it still happens.  If it does, then it's likely just you moving around that's doing it.  If it doesn't, then you can simply uncheck "allow this device to wake the computer" in her network adapter properties (should be under power management), you know, next time she leaves lol.
